Position Summary

Responsible for supporting the implementation of energy and water management solutions to help clients achieve energy and sustainability goals.

Acting as an extension of the client’s in-house team, the Energy Manager will leverage technical expertise and market segment knowledge to deliver insights that drive sustainable business decisions for multi-site commercial and industrial clients domestically and internationally.
 

Role Description:

Client Focus


• Advise and support client staff (corporate energy managers, facility managers, engineers, technicians) in identifying and scoping efficiency improvements and cost control strategies and help drive their implementation to enable our clients to successfully meet their energy and sustainability goals

• Ensure on-time delivery of high quality, error free products

• Build relationships with key client contacts from site-level personnel up to senior leadership (e.g. VP Operations/Facilities)

• Increase the breadth and depth of client engagements by positioning yourself and ENGIE Insight as a trusted advisor

• Participate in client presentations, meetings and discussions, interfacing with internal ENGIE Insight stakeholders to communicate program activities and the quantification and qualification of the value delivered

Technical Expertise

• Combine technical (e.g. equipment, systems, buildings) and market segment (e.g. hospitality, restaurant, grocery) expertise to support the resolution of complex energy and water management issues

• Leverage metering, monitoring, benchmarking, analytical tools, and software to analyze and provide insight into key areas of focus for improving energy and water performance

• Lead identification, evaluation and prioritization of capital projects, operational changes and physical plant upgrades that result in reduced energy and water consumption and demand

• Conduct ENERGY STAR® Certification site visits

Role Competencies


·  Bachelor’s degree in business, engineering or associated field required 
·  Certified Energy Manager (CEM) preferred
·  Relevant industry certifications preferred (e.g. CWEP, CEA, BESA, EBCP, LEED)3+ years of direct experience in energy or sustainability management or related field, or equivalent combination of education and experience sufficient to perform the essential functions of the job 
·  Demonstrated experience in any of the following areas: 
·  Demand Management: demand response, capital projects, operational changes, audit, plant optimization, building systems and equipment, controls strategies, building energy modeling
·  Water Conservation: equipment, smart metering, reclamation, audit, risk management, irrigation
·  Metering and Monitoring: interval metering, continuous monitoring, energy management systems 
·  Renewable Energy: PPA development, solar planning/installation/management, battery and storage, distributed energy resources, wind Operational knowledge in any of the following market segments: Hospitality, Restaurants, Grocery, Retail, Industrial
